Focaccia col formaggio is Liguria’s ultra-thin cheese-filled flatbread, famed nearby in Recco and widely loved around the Gulf of Tigullio.
Pesto alla Genovese is the region’s signature basil sauce, traditionally pounded with pine nuts, Parmigiano, pecorino, garlic and olive oil.
Farinata is a baked chickpea flour pancake with olive oil, a classic Ligurian street food valued for its simple coastal tradition.

Prices are higher than many Italian towns due to Riviera tourism. Hotels and dining rise in peak season, while local trains and buses stay fairly reasonable.
Service is often included or covered by coperto. Round up or leave 5-10% for great restaurant service. Taxis are usually rounded up. Small change is fine in cafes.
